A Smartwhip canister should never be selected by appearance alone. Before ordering, record the exact manufacturer and model of the regulator, connector or culinary siphon already on the bench. Compare those details with the current instructions for the listed Smartwhip product. A fitting that looks familiar is not proof of compatibility.
Capacity is another part of the product identity. Searches sometimes attach 560 g, 580 g, 2 kg or 3 kg to the Smartwhip name. The local catalogue is the source for what is actually offered here, and its current Smartwhip listing is 666 g. If the catalogue changes, the live product page—not an old search phrase—should guide the enquiry.
Package weight does not promise a fixed number of portions. Recipe, ingredient temperature, dispensing settings, portion standard and the way the kitchen operates all affect practical yield. A venue should measure its own ordinary service instead of copying a universal estimate from another kitchen.
